NordVPN's next-generation antivirus achieved a 94% detection rate for phishing threats in an evaluation by AV-Comparatives, tested against 250 active phishing URLs and recording zero false positives. The antivirus also demonstrated a 92% block rate in similar independent testing and ranked third overall in speed and malware protection behind Avast and Norton. It is included in NordVPN's Complete subscription tier and operates alongside the standard VPN tunnel to block trackers, ads, and malicious sites in real-time. Users are advised to maintain vigilance and practice strong digital hygiene, including scrutinizing URLs and enabling two-factor authentication for added security.

Google has introduced several network security enhancements in Android 17 to improve user privacy. One key feature is Encrypted Client Hello (ECH), which encrypts domain names to prevent external observers from monitoring user activities. ECH is integrated with private DNS and is enabled by default for apps using compatible networking libraries. Google claims to be the first major mobile operating system to implement widespread ECH support. Testing conducted by Jigsaw showed stable connection success rates and minimal interference across various networks. Additional security features in Android 17 include: - Local Network Protection, requiring apps to request permission before accessing devices on a user's home network. - Certificate Transparency, mandating public logging of certificates to detect forged ones. - A 2G Network Shutdown option for mobile operators to disable 2G services, reducing exposure to phishing messages.

ESET NOD32 Antivirus is an antivirus solution designed to protect Windows PCs from various threats, including viruses, spyware, rootkits, and zero-day exploits, while maintaining system performance. It offers a one-year license for a competitive price and is recognized for its effective threat detection and minimal impact on system resources. Key features include real-time scanning, a Ransomware Shield that blocks file-locking attempts, advanced artificial intelligence for identifying new threats, and an anti-phishing feature that prevents access to fraudulent websites.

Windows holds a 71 percent share of the desktop market, with over 1.6 billion active Windows PCs globally. In contrast, macOS accounts for just over seven percent of the market, rising to nearly 20 percent when combined with OS X. Windows users face a variety of threats, including trojans and riskware, and in 2025, Windows users encountered seven times more malware than macOS users. Surfshark's data indicates that macOS users are increasingly targeted by phishing attacks, which pose significant financial and personal risks.

Android Pulse is a diagnostic tool distributed by Google since March, which has recently become visible to the public and is now on over 10 million devices. It operates without a user interface and monitors software for unusual system resource consumption. The app first appeared in March with seven builds before being listed in the Play Store. On Pixel devices, it is found in system settings, while on others, it appears as a blank square in the update queue. There was no formal announcement regarding its rollout. Europe has enacted regulations to enhance user control over devices, but essential system applications like Android Pulse are exempt from easy uninstallation. There is no evidence that Android Pulse poses a danger, but its late visibility raised user concerns.
